Extended Limits of Confinement includes which of the following?

Explanation:
Extended limits of confinement refers to sanctions that keep a person under supervision and constraint outside a traditional prison setting. A community service order fits this idea most directly because it requires the offender to perform a set number of hours of service while being monitored and legally bound to meet the obligation. This creates a time-bound, supervision-based constraint in the community, extending the reach of the justice system beyond the prison walls without actual incarceration. Long-term imprisonment in a federal facility is standard confinement behind bars, not an extension of confinement outside a facility. Residential treatment or halfway houses are more like supervised living arrangements, still close to a facility. Monetary fines with probation involve financial penalties and a probation period but do not impose the same kind of concrete, time-bound service and daily constraint that a community service requirement does.
